To present the first 22-months experience of transitioning to an ultrasound-first pathway for suspected midgut malrotation.
An "ultrasound-first" imaging pathway was initiated in October 2021. Twenty-two-months later, a search was undertaken of all <1-year-old patients with "bilious", "malrotation," or "volvulus" as the imaging indication. Reports and images from upper gastrointestinal fluoroscopy (UGI) and ultrasound were reviewed, and diagnoses and outcomes were documented.
The search yielded 101 eligible cases between October 2021 and July 2023. Of the patients, 63/101 (62%) had both ultrasound and UGI: 47/63 (75%) ultrasound first, 16/63 (25%) UGI first. Thirty-one per cent (31/101) had ultrasound only and 7/70 (10%) UGI only. The pathway diagnosed 7/8 (88%) infants with midgut malrotation with or without volvulus and one infant who had an inconclusive ultrasound examination with a suspected an internal hernia and who was found to have malrotation volvulus at surgery. Twenty-one infants who had confidently normal ultrasound examinations and who also had UGI all had a normal duodenojejunal flexure position. Ultrasound detected alternative pathology in eight children. Duodenal visualisation improved with time: 6/15 (40%) in the first 6 months to 23/34 (68%) after the first year.
The transition to ultrasound as the first diagnostic test for midgut malrotation can be done safely and effectively in a UK centre, which previously relied solely on UGI.
